Ingredients

For the Chicken Skewers

  • 2 lbs chicken tenders, thighs or breast
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 stick butter
  • 8-10 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/2 cup parmesan, grated
  • 1 tbsp hot sauce (more if desired)
  • 2 teaspoons red pepper flakes
  • 1/3 cup fresh parsley, minced
  • 2 teaspoons paprika
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on pepper

How to Make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

Start by cutting your chicken into bite-sized pieces. This ensures even cooking and makes it easier to skewer.

Step 2: Make the Garlic Parmesan Sauce

In a mixing bowl:
Melt the butter in the microwave or on the stove.
Add minced garlic, grated parmesan, hot sauce, red pepper flakes, parsley, pa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per.
Mix until well combined.

Step 3: Marinate the Chicken

Place the cut chicken pieces in the mixing bowl with the garlic parmesan sauce:
Stir until all pieces are well coated.
Let it marinate for at least 10 minutes for maximum flavor absorption.

Step 4: Assemble the Skewers

Preheat your air fryer while assembling:
Thread marinated chicken onto skewers.
Ensure there’s space between each piece for even cooking.

Step 5: Cook in Air Fryer

Place the skewers in your air fryer basket:
Cook at 375°F (190°C) for about 15 minutes.
Turn halfway through for even browning.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Avoiding common mistakes can elevate your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ers to perfection.

  • Using the Wrong Cut of Chicken: Different chicken cuts cook differently. Stick to tenders or thighs for tender, juicy skewers.
  • Not Marinating Long Enough: Marinating helps infuse flavor. Aim for at least 30 minutes to allow the garlic and parmesan to penetrate the chicken.
  • Skipping the Soaking of Skewers: If using wooden skewers, soak them in water for 30 minutes. This prevents burning during cooking.
  • Overcrowding the Skewers: Leave space between chicken pieces on the skewer. This ensures even cooking and promotes a good char.
  • Neglecting Basting: Baste your skewers regularly with garlic parmesan butter while cooking. This adds moisture and enhances flavor.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store cooked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ers in an airtight container.
  • They will last up to 3 days in the refrigerator.

Freezing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ers

  • Freeze cooked skewers in a single layer on a baking sheet before transferring them to a freezer-safe bag.
  • They can be frozen for up to 3 months.

Reheating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 10-15 minutes until heated through.
  • Microwave: Place skewers on a microwave-safe plate and heat in short intervals, checking often to avoid drying out.
  • Stovetop: Heat in a skillet over medium heat, adding a little olive oil if necessary to prevent sticking.

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some common questions about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ers.

Can I use other meats for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ers?

Yes, you can substitute chicken with shrimp or tofu for a different twist on this recipe.

How do I make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ers spicy?

Add more hot sauce or include fresh chopped jalapeños into the marinade for extra heat.

Can I grill these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ers?

Absolutely! Follow the same marinating instructions, then grill them over medium heat until cooked through.

What can I serve with Garlic Parmesan Chicken Skewers?

These skewers pair well with rice, grilled vegetables, or a fresh salad for a balanced meal.
